Md. Code Ann., Public Safety § 3-530 (2026).

Text

(a)The Governor’s Office of Crime Prevention and Policy shall request and analyze data relating to juveniles who are charged, convicted, and sentenced as adults in the State, including data from:
(1)law enforcement agencies in the State;
(2)the Administrative Office of the Courts;
(3)local correctional facilities in the State; and
(4)the Department of Public Safety and Correctional Services.
(b)The information collected and analyzed under subsection (a) of this section shall include:
(1)the number of juveniles charged, convicted, and sentenced as adults;
